Gain the merchants’ confidence

Once you, as a new , decide that you intend to utilize products you should contact the affiliate merchants to let them know what marketing strategy you are using – or will use – to promote their products, even while you ask for their advice as to what they have found to be the most effective strategy for marketing such products.

Merchants will know their product the best and they will have a good idea of the strategies being employed by other affiliates that have been proven most successful in making sales. In addition, contacting the merchant also shows them that you are dedicated to achieving vocation, which should give them some extra incentive to work more cooperatively with you.

Keep in mind that once you have stated your intention and disclosed your marketing strategy to these merchants, they might make the extra effort to design (or brand) marketing materials specifically for you, so it is important that you be consistent in your approach, topic and medium. Dealing directly with merchants

The more success you have blogging about a particular topic, the more interest you will create in your blog, such that if and when you email a merchant and they don’t respond, you should have no problem getting the attention of other merchants; and you should really refrain from any dealings (partnership?) with a merchant who fails to communicate, since such failure might be indicative of other problems, such as refusal or failure to pay your commission.

An affiliate marketing partnership is by no means a problem-free arrangement, since it has been shown to involve a number of problems, including but not limited to, poor quality products, poor/non-existent customer service and failure/refusal to pay affiliate commissions. Keep in mind that some merchants also make big promises and set high payout rates knowing full well that very few affiliates will actually meet their objectives. You should avoid working with such merchants.

Communicating with merchants

When you communicate with merchants, you should ensure that you use a professional tone; and if you have suggestions on how a merchant can improve his/her offers, you should let them know, because most merchants appreciate feedback, and know that a lot of the feedback they receive can improve their programs.

Always remember that smart merchants understand the value of good affiliates and will treat you with respect, assist you with resources, and pay your commissions promptly; while smart affiliates understand that merchants want quality promotion and sales performance.

To get the most out of your partnership, you should always be professional and make an effort to cooperate with your merchant; and try to understand that good merchants are always busy, which might make them seem like they aren’t that good; but be assured that they will answer your questions and emails, even if it takes them a bit more time.

The longer you work with a merchant, the more you will understand how they do things; but if you are just starting out in affiliate marketing, you have to realize that a merchant can help you understand how things work. Elements of opt-in marketing

While there are companies and individual entities that are all too eager to help you – for a fee – with website creation, Web-based business building, and clientele development, it is important to keep in mind that there also many cost-free ways in which you can spread the word about your website’s existence on the Web that are direct and as effective as the fee-based methods; and one such cost-free method used by many marketers is Opt-in email marketing (permission marketing).

Opt-in marketing requires the permission of a willing customer to subscribe to the marketing materials of a Web marketer, with the understanding that such materials would be comprised of suitable and acceptable content in the form of catalogs, newsletters, and promotional mailings via e-mail; and the marketer understands that the more opt-in marketing email s/he can send, the more chances s/he has to make sales. But such an email marketing business can only be done by building a list consisting of all individuals who wants to subscribe to your content and marketing materials.

Good Web form and impressive homepage

Installing a good web form on your website that immediately follows the end of your content has been shown to be one of the best ways to attract a visitors attention to your opt-in list; and while there are those who might say that this is too soon to invite a website visitor to subscribe to your list, it is important to remember that your homepage provides a quick good impression of your overall website and business, whereas if somehow a website visitor finds something s/he doesn’t like on another page and has a negative reaction to it s/he could be lost forever.

besides, a good web form for subscribing to an opt-in list is really not hard to do, since it requires a short and simple written statement about how they would like to see more and get updated about the site. Then there should be an area where they could put in their names and e-mail addresses, and this web form will automatically save and send you the data that was inputted; and your list will grow proportionately as more people sign in.

As mentioned earlier, the homepage (landing page) of a website is the most important page on that site because it is often the first page an individual sees when s/he visits the site, so it’s critical that you make your homepage as impressive as you can. You need to have well-written articles, attractive graphics and a well-defined description of your website; and, depending on what your site is all about, you need to capture the visitor’s fancy.

In other words, make your site useful, very easy to use and easy to navigate; and to do this you have to keep in mind, while creating the site, that most your visitors are probably not tech savvy and therefore may not understand the reasons for the presence or absence of certain website features. Investing in good programming for your site in order to make your graphics beautiful and page loading fast will be helpful, but try not to overdo it, because too much can sometimes be as bad as not enough.

Don’t waste your time making the homepage overly large and bulky megabyte-wise since this can lead to the page opening too slow and your visitors will not have the patience to sit there waiting for it to open. This is especially important when approached from the viewpoint that not all people have dedicated T1 connections; so the faster your site gets loaded, the better it is for your visitors which works to your advantage in the long run.
